He did say that Jay and Bob would never come back but Jason Mewes, his best friend and the one playing Jay had been fighting a terrible drug addiction, mainly heroïn. He was a mess, his teeths had fallen, etc. When he was on the verge of succeeding his therapy to quit, Kevin told him that if he would quit completely, he would make another Jay and Silent Bob movie. He was thinking about doing a Clerks 2 for sometime now, because he had something to say and Clerks was the best vehicle for it.

As for Mallrats 2, it'd be rather unlikely, but if it were to come true, if done right, I wouldn't mind.
